Availability

We are available any time during the school year, although we do work outside of the home (teachers). Often, we can come home midday for walks/visits, but your dog would be alone on school days for 4-5 hours. We are available on most weekends and school vacations/days off. We are home full-time in July & August. **If you have a dog who is wee-wee pad trained and/or can hold him/herself for 4-5 hours, we are happy to do weekdays/full week(s) from Sept-June provided you are comfortable with your dog being alone during the work week for about 4-5 hours at a stretch. We can often come home for a potty break/walk/visit around lunchtime, so feel free to inquire about your needs to see if we would be a good fit for a given time.**

Information Janna W. would like to know about your pet

In order to accept a dog into our home, they should be generally calm/friendly with people, be very comfortable with older children (our youngest is 7 years old), be house-trained, and/or use wee-wee pads. Please note, we cap large dogs at 60 pounds. If your dog experiences separation anxiety (excessive whining, barking, or pacing behaviors) and/or you consider your dog "high energy," we are likely *not* a good fit. Additionally, we cannot host "escape artists" or dogs with any history of biting/aggressive behavior.

Pet care experience

We are a family of 4 (mom, dad, and two girls - ages 7 and 15) in a private home with a fenced yard in Greenburgh (10607). We have had three dogs and several small animals as part of our family, but our last dog crossed the rainbow bridge in September 2022. After some time to grieve, we look forward to sharing our home with your best fur friend while you are away. We are committed to your dog being the sole focus of our love and attention. We only board ONE dog at a time to ensure their comfort and happiness. We are comfortable giving pill medications, if needed.
